Abstract

The utility model relates to the technical field of sewer garbage disposal, in particular to a convenient sewer garbage disposal device, which comprises a filter plate, a well, a first motor, a cleaning rod, a crushing box, two crushing rollers, cylindrical gears, a second motor and a garbage temporary storage box, wherein the filter plate is arranged in the well, the right side of the well is provided with a notch, the first motor is arranged at the bottom end of the filter plate, the cleaning rod is fixedly connected to the power output end of the first motor, the crushing box is arranged at the right side of the well, the two crushing rollers are arranged in the crushing box in a bilateral symmetry way, the front and the rear ends of the crushing rollers are respectively and rotatably connected to the front and the rear side walls of the crushing box through rotating bearings, the two cylindrical gears are both fixedly connected to the rear end of the crushing roller, and the two cylindrical gears are meshed with each other, the utility model solves, large volume and inconvenient regular maintenance and garbage cleaning.

Referring to FIGS. 1-5: a convenient sewer garbage disposal device comprises a filter plate 1, a well 2, a motor I3, a cleaning rod 4, a crushing box 5, a crushing roller 6, a cylindrical gear 7, a motor II 8 and a garbage temporary storage box 9;
filter 1 sets up in well 2, 2 right sides in well are seted up jaggedly 21, motor 3 sets up in filter 1 bottom, 4 fixed connection of cleaning rod are on 3 power take off of motor, broken case 5 sets up in 2 right sides in well, broken gyro wheel 6 has two and bilateral symmetry to set up inside broken case 5, both ends rotate respectively through rolling bearing around broken gyro wheel 6 and connect on the wall of broken case 5 front and back both sides, roller gear 7 has two and equal fixed connection in 6 rear ends of broken gyro wheel, two roller gear 7 mesh mutually, motor two 8 set up in 5 front sides in broken case, motor two 8 power take off ends and the 6 fixed connection of the broken gyro wheel in left side, rubbish temporary storage box 9 sets up in 5 bottoms in broken case.
Specifically, the bottom of filter 1 evenly is provided with projection 101, and 2 inner walls of well evenly are provided with the carrier block 22 corresponding with projection 101, and projection 101 is pegged graft on carrier block 22.
Specifically, the left side and the right side of the top of the crushing box 5 are symmetrically provided with inclined plates 51, so that garbage can conveniently flow into the crushing rollers 6.
Specifically, the bottoms of the front side and the rear side of the crushing box 5 are fixedly connected with fixing strips 52, and dovetail grooves 53 are formed in the bottom ends of the fixing strips 52.
Specifically, the front side and the rear side of the top end of the garbage temporary storage box 9 are symmetrically provided with dovetail blocks 91, the dovetail blocks 91 are tangent to the dovetail grooves 53, the dovetail blocks 91 are connected in the dovetail grooves 53 in a sliding mode, and the garbage temporary storage box 9 can be taken down and cleaned conveniently through sliding connection.
The working principle is as follows: the utility model is connected to an external power supply, the motor I3 and the motor II 8 run cooperatively, when garbage flows into the filter plate 1 in the sewer pipeline 2, the motor I3 drives the cleaning rod 4 to rotate, the cleaning rod 4 rotates to clean the garbage on the filter plate 1, when the garbage moves to the gap 21, the garbage can flow into the crushing box 5 along the inclined plate 51, thereby avoiding the garbage blocking the sewer and causing the trouble of sewer operation, meanwhile, the motor II 8 drives the crushing roller 6, because the two cylindrical gears 7 at the rear end of the crushing roller 6 are meshed, thereby the two crushing rollers 6 rotate relatively to extrude and crush the garbage, thereby the garbage falls into the garbage temporary storage box 9 to be temporarily stored, because the filter plate 1 is inserted and installed with the bearing block 22 through the convex column 101, the filter plate 1 can be taken out only by pulling up during maintenance, the garbage temporary storage box can be taken out through the dovetail groove 53 and the dovetail block 91 in a matching sliding way, clear up rubbish, simple structure facilitates the use, improves the efficiency that the clearance was maintained to the sewer, has very strong practicality.
